NACTA vows to intensify efforts to eradicate terrorism

ISLAMABAD: The National Counter Terrorism Authority (NACTA) has reiterated to take all possible measures to root out terrorism from society.

This was vowed during the monthly Counter Terrorism Intelligence Conference of NACTA held in Islamabad on Tuesday.

Members of Police, Law Enforcement Agencies and Intelligence Agencies attended the conference.

Security situation of the country was reviewed and actionable intelligence shared among stakeholders.

It was also reiterated that terrorism will be rooted out from Pakistani society with a concerted effort of all LEAs.
